Abstract
A laser light scattering and spectroscopic detector is provided which includes a probe comprising an optical fiber coupled to a graded index microlens. The angular aperture and the divergence of the probe are designed specifically to satisfy the scattering volume and coherence requirements for laser light scattering and spectroscopic measurements. The detector includes a housing which defines an elongate cell therein and a selected number of detector ports extending at various angles with respect to the cell. A method is provided for detecting scattered light which includes the steps of positioning the probe inside or outside the scattering medium at a selected angle with respect to the laser beam.
